In the emergency the most far-seeing recommended a more unbending policy of extermination.Among these, one in particular, a statesman bearing an illustrious name of two-edged import, distinguished himself bythe liberal broad-mindedness of his opinions, and for the time he even did not flinch from ****** himself excessively unpopular by the wide and sweeping variety of his censure."We are confessedly a barbarian nation," fearlessly declared this unprejudiced person (who, although entitled by hereditary right to carry a banner on the field of battle, with patriotic self- effacement preferred to remain at home and encourage those who were fighting by pointing out their inadequacy to the task and the extreme unlikelihood of their ever accomplishing it), "and in order to achieve our purpose speedily it is necessary to resort to the methods of barbarism." The most effective measure, as he proceeded to explain with well-thought- out detail, would be to capture all those least capable of resistance, concentrate them into a given camp, and then at an agreed signal reduce the entire assembly to what he termed, in a passage of high-minded eloquence, "a smoking hecatomb of women and children."His advice was pointed with a crafty insight, for not only would such a course have brought the stubborn enemy to a realisation of the weakness of their position and thus paved the way to a dignified peace, but by the act itself few would have been left to hand down the tradition of a relentless antagonism.Yet with incredible obtuseness his advice was ignored and he himself was referred to at the time by those who regarded the matter from a different angle, with a scarcely-veiled dislike, which towards many of his followers took the form of building materials and other dissentient messages whenever they attempted to raise their voices publicly.As an inevitable result the conquest of the country took years, where it would have been moons had the more truly humane policy been adopted, commerce and the arts languished, and in the end so little spoil was taken that it was more common to meet six mendicants wearing the honourable embellishment of the campaign than to see one captured slave maiden offered for sale in the market places--indeed, even to this day the deficiency is clearly admitted and openly referred to as The Great "Domestic" Problem.*At various times during my residence here I have been filled with a most acute gratification when the words of those around have seemed to indicate that they recognised the undoubted superiority of the laws andinstitutions of our enlightened country.Sometimes, it is true, upon a more detailed investigation of the incident, it has presently appeared that either I had misunderstood the exact nature of their sentiments or they had slow- wittedly failed to grasp the precise operation of the enactment I had described; but these exceptions are clearly the outcome of their superficial training, and do not affect the fact my feeble and frequently even eccentric arguments are at length certainly moving the more intelligent into an admission of what constitutes true justice and refinement.It is not to be denied that here and there exists a prejudice against our customs even in the minds of the studious; but as this is invariably the shadow of misconception, it has frequently been my sympathetic privilege to promote harmony by means of the inexorable logic of fact and reason."But are not your officials uncompromisingly opposed to the ******* of the Press?" said one who conversed with me on the varying phases of the two countries, and knowing that in his eyes this would constitute an unendurable offence, I at once appeased his mind."By no means," I replied; "if anything, the exact contrary is the case.As a matter of reality, of course, there is no Press now, the all-seeing Board of Censors having wisely determined that it was not stimulating to the public welfare; but if such an institution was permitted to exist you may rest genially assured that nothing could exceed the lenient toleration which all in office would extend towards it." A similar instance of malicious inaccuracy is widely spoken of regarding our lesser ones."Is it really a fact, Mr.Kong," exclaimed a maiden of magnanimous condescension, to this person recently, "that we poor women are despised in your country, and that among the working-classes female children are even systematically abandoned as soon as they are born?" Suffering my features to express amusement at this unending calumny, I indicated my violent contempt towards the one who had first uttered it."So far from despising them," I continued, with ingratiating gallantry, "we recognise that they are quite necessary for the purposes of preparing our food, carrying weighty burdens, and the like; and how grotesque an action would it be for poor but affectionate parents to abandon one who in a few years' time could be sold at a really remunerative profit, this, indeed, being the principal meansof sustenance in many frugal families."

On another occasion I had seated myself upon a wooden couch in one of the open spaces about the outskirts of the city, when an aged man chanced to pass by.Him I saluted with ceremonious politeness, on account of his years and the venerable dignity of his beard.Thereupon he approached near, and remarking affably that the afternoon was good (though, to use no subtle evasion, it was very evil), he congenially sat by my side and entered into familiar discourse.
